About the Role:

In this fulfilling position, you'll play a pivotal role in creating a nurturing environment for students with SEMH needs. Your responsibilities will include:

  • Providing individualized assistance to students, promoting their social and emotional development.
  • Collaborating closely with teachers and SEMH specialists to implement personalized support plans and effective behavior management strategies.
  • Assisting in diverse classroom activities, ensuring the engagement and participation of students facing SEMH challenges.
  • Developing positive and trustful relationships with students, contributing to their overall well-being and personal growth.

Qualifications and Skills:

We are seeking candidates with:

  • Previous experience in a school or care setting, supporting students dealing with social, emotional, and mental health challenges.
  • A solid understanding of SEMH conditions and effective strategies for support.
  • Strong communication skills, with the ability to empathetically connect with students and enhance their social and emotional development.
  • Compassion, patience, and empathy, driven by a genuine passion for supporting students facing SEMH challenges.
  • Flexibility and adaptability to cater to the diverse needs of students across different age groups and abilities.
  • A valid enhanced DBS (Disclosure and Barring Service) check or a willingness to obtain one.
  • Relevant qualifications, such as CACHE Level 2 or 3 in Supporting Teaching and Learning or equivalent.
